However, if you have a bit more time to spare, the station also offers some fantastic sit-down options. One of the most talked-about spots is the Restaurant 1900, located in the former Royal waiting room. This place is pure class, guys. Stepping inside feels like traveling back in time, with its opulent decor and a menu that complements the ambiance. They often serve classic Belgian dishes and have a great selection of drinks. It’s the kind of place where you can truly relax and enjoy a meal, making your wait for a train a pleasure rather than a chore. Tips for Dining at Antwerpen Centraal

Alright, let's wrap this up with some pro tips for making the most of the Antwerpen Centraal Station restaurants. First off, know your timeline. If you're rushing for a train, stick to the reliable grab-and-go spots mentioned earlier. Panos, or even a quick coffee and pastry, will save you stress. Don't attempt a sit-down meal if you only have 15 minutes – trust me on this one, guys! Conversely, if you have an hour or more, then consider the sit-down options like Restaurant 1900 or a nearby brasserie. Booking ahead, especially for popular places like Restaurant 1900, can be a lifesaver, particularly during peak travel times or weekends.

Secondly, explore beyond the obvious. As we discussed, the immediate vicinity of the station is packed with great food. Use your phone's map to scout for highly-rated local spots just a few minutes' walk away. You might find a hidden gem that offers a more authentic experience. Thirdly, check reviews. Before settling on a place, especially if it's not a well-known chain, take a minute to check online reviews. Sites like TripAdvisor or Google Maps can give you a good indication of food quality, service, and ambiance. Fourth, embrace the local flavors. Don't be afraid to try Belgian specialties like stoofvlees, moules-frites (mussels and fries), or a delicious Belgian waffle. Pair it with a local beer for the full experience! Finally, be aware of opening hours. Stations can have extended hours, but individual restaurants, especially smaller, independent ones nearby, might have specific closing times. Always double-check if you’re planning a late meal.
